5 – 11 July 2006 We stayed six nights there and here is our feedback: ADVANTAGES: 1. Magnificent view of Chaweng and beyond. 2. Balcony the size of the bedroom. Wonderful and breathtaking view from there. 3. Wonderful swimming pool. 4. Peace and quiet. 5. Very polite and helpful cleaners. DISADVANTAGES: 1. No breakfast!! No restaurant. We took it for granted that at least one restaurant in such a beautiful little resort would be there. The “breakfast” we found instead was one little cup of whole corn kernel and red bean yogurt, a few slices of white bread, a small jar of cheap jam, eggs, and a carton of unhealthy juice. Plus of course some instant coffee and regular tea bags. 2. Filthy pillows! We had to request clean ones on our first day there when we conducted our customary checkup of the room. 3. The resort is located on the top of a mountain. Getting up there was a nightmare. Taxi drivers refused to drive up there, except for one the hotel manager knew who charged 300 bahts each way to/from Chaweng and/or Lamai. 4. Resort has no lobby, just a tiny office that always seems to be closed. 5. This is not a hotel for families with children. CONCLUSION: Despite the unparalleled view from the room and swimming pool, we would never stay there again!! M. Aftat and N. Slimani

March 2007 From Nov. 15 2006 until end of March 2007 we spend 4 ½ months here at Samui Mountain Village. It is the best place for staying ‘long time’ between Chaweng and Lamai Beach. It is offering more comfort than some so called 4 and 5 stars hotels down at the beaches. The owners, all the staff, will take care of you. Any problems will be handled immediately and solved as good as they can do. Due to the height of the property (120 Meters above sea level) you always have a good climate, round about 4 degrees less than down at the Beach. It is really comfortable. And very importand, come as a stranger and leave as a friend. Rudy and Siegi Gruber, Wassenburg, Germany (Bavaria – Near the Alps)
